Возрастные особенности усвоения лексической семантики

Abstract

Данная ВКР выполнена в русле психолингвистического подхода к трактовке значения как единицы языкового сознания. Обосновывается необходимость различать значение слова и знание его индивидом (выявлять личностные смыслы, психологическую реальность значения).В центре внимания автора – процесс усвоения лексической семантики детьми на разных этапах речевого развития и особенностей употребления слов в речи детей разных возрастных групп. В качестве материала исследования используются данные психолингвистического эксперимента, направленного на выявление динамики усвоения лексической семантики слова детьми четырех возрастных групп (дошкольники, младшие школьники, подростки, старшеклассники). Практическая значимость исследования заключается в возможности использования его результатов в учебной практике.
